Origins

Serve in a Coupe glass

Ingredients:
1 slice Fresh ginger root (thumbnail-sized slice)
2 oz Light white rum (charcoal-filtered 1-4 years old)
16 oz Rioja (Crianza) red wine
12 oz Lime juice (freshly squeezed)
14 oz Monin Grenadine Syrup

Garnish: Fresh ginger slice

How to make:

MUDDLE ginger in base of shaker. Add other ingredients, SHAKE with ice and fine strain into chilled glass.

A pinky red daiquiri with ginger spice, sweet pomegranate and Rioja wine.

History:

Created in 2010 by John O'Reilly at the Apartment, Belfast, Northern Ireland. This adaptation of the classic Daiquiri was inspired by the man who created Bacardi rum and his move from Spain to Cuba. The Rioja represents Don Facundo's Spanish homeland, the pomegranate was taken by the Spanish to the New World and so stands for the journey itself, while the ginger represents the heat and spice of the Caribbean.
